Remembering C.C. Hennix & Denny Laine
Catherine Christer Hennix - Drone music pioneer - 25 Jan. 1948 - 19 Nov. 2023
Denny Laine - Co-founder of Moody Blues and Wings - 29 Oct. 1944 - 05 Dec. 2023

| Balls Fight for My Country Trevor Burton single 1969 This is the longer version of the single, a French import. Alan White is in the center, Trevor Burton (from The Move) to the left, and Denny Laine on the right. Brum rock at its best ("Brum"=Birmingham). Denny Laine played bass. Guitarist Steve Gibbons, from the Uglys, and the Uglys' drummer Keith Smart were also in the band at various times. |
